Abstract

This study aims to determine the effect of work motivation on employee performance at PT. Jaya Kencana, the effect of compensation on employee performance at PT. Jaya Kencana, the influence of the environment on the performance of employees at PT. Jaya Kencana, and the effect of work motivation, compensation, and work environment simultaneously on employee performance at PT. Jaya Kencana. The method used in this research is descriptive quantitative method. This research was conducted by looking for primary data with a sample size of 100 employees of PT. Jaya Kencana. The data were processed by statistical analysis with validity, reliability, classical assumption test, multiple linear regression analysis, hypothesis testing through t test and F test, and analysis of the determinant coefficient (R). From the results of the analysis, it shows that the results of the multiple linear regression test are Y= 5.526 + 0.481X1 + 0.133X2 + 0.357X3 and for the F test results it is found that H0 is rejected and Ha is accepted with a value of Fcount 57.663 > Ftable 2.99 at significant 0.000 < Ftable 0.05. So the F test shows that work motivation, compensation, and work environment together (simultaneously) have a positive and significant effect on employee performance at PT. Jaya Kencana with the percentage of the coefficient of determination of 63.2%.
